Personal Statement

I'd like to thank you for taking a moment to view my profile and allowing me the opportunity to give a brief insight of who I am. I firmly believe in a solid academic background, as it is a stepping stone for greater achievements in life. Although my transcripts reflect my dedication to education, it fails to encompass my enthusiasm towards being a strong leader in my community. It is through service that a leader truly understands what is meant to lead others which is why I dedicate a lot of additional hours (above what is required) of my time in community service projects and  volunteer work. It is my ultimate goal to obtain a 4-year degree and then serve my country as a Marine Corps Officer. 

My life-long commitment to physical fitness has enabled my ability to push myself to higher limits in athletics both mentally and physically. Long Distance/Cross Country is where my athletic strengths lie; however,  I was recently awarded 2 Metals for Physical Fitness Achievement on a Regional Level for ranking #3 in the Military Cadence Sit-ups category and #4 in Military Cadence Push-ups category. My fastest official timed mile was 5:19; however, I have broken this record during numerous runs.  My training in NJROTC has taught me to keep pushing myself physically and mentally.

In summary, I believe that high academic scores and strong athletic abilities are beneficial, but it's one's moral character and values that make a person successful not only in school but also in life. If given the chance to represent your University, I will make it an upmost priority to uphold the principles and standards of your University with high academics, strong athletic ability, and an unwavering moral compass.
